Reviewed Education and Training standards
12 Aug 2021
NZQA National Qualifications Services (NQS) invite you to provide feedback on the review of 40 unit standards at Levels 4-5 currently listed on the Directory of Assessment Standards (DAS) in Adult Education and Training and Generic Education and Training.
The review includes consideration of the recommended pathways leading to recently reviewed Adult and Tertiary Teaching and Assessment qualifications.
Information about the standards review and the draft standards are available from the review page.
